Donkeys and Mules in Load Bearing

Donkeys and mules serve a vital role in load-bearing transport, thanks to their strength, endurance, and adaptability. These animals have been selectively bred for generations, making them ideal for carrying heavy and bulky loads across varied terrains.

Donkeys are particularly renowned for their sure-footedness and ability to traverse steep, rugged landscapes. They can carry significant weights, typically 20 to 30 percent of their body weight, making them indispensable in agricultural and mountainous regions. Mules, the offspring of a male donkey and a female horse, combine the desirable traits of both species. Their larger size, coupled with their donkey heritage, allows them to carry heavier loads and navigate extensively.

Key advantages of using donkeys and mules for load-bearing include:

  • High endurance levels, ideal for long journeys
  • Low maintenance needs compared to mechanical vehicles
  • Environmental sustainability, as they rely on natural food sources

These attributes have cemented donkeys and mules as essential components in various transportation methodologies across the globe. Their persistence in load-bearing tasks highlights the long-standing relationship between animal domestication and transport solutions.

Camels and the Transportation of Goods in Arid Regions

Camels are uniquely adapted to thrive in arid regions, making them vital for transport in harsh desert environments. These animals excel at carrying heavy loads over long distances and can travel without water for several days, making them indispensable for traders and nomadic peoples.

The physiology of camels allows them to withstand extreme heat and conserve water efficiently. Their ability to store fat in their humps provides energy during prolonged journeys, while their tough hooves suit the terrain. With a capacity to carry loads of up to 600 pounds, camels outclass other transport animals in harsh conditions.

Benefits of using camels for transport include:

  • Efficient navigation through sandy terrain
  • Ability to travel for days without water
  • Adaptability to extreme weather variations

Historically, caravans utilizing camels facilitated trade routes, such as the Silk Road, connecting disparate regions. Their enduring presence in commerce underscores the significance of animal domestication for transport, particularly in challenging landscapes.

Carriages and Carts Driven by Horses

Carriages and carts driven by horses have been integral to transportation methods throughout history. Essential for moving goods and people, these vehicles harness the strength and endurance of horses, enhancing the efficiency of transport systems. Varieties of horse-drawn vehicles, such as wagons, carriages, and chariots, showcased how animal domestication transformed travel across distances.

Wagons served primarily in agricultural and trade settings, designed for heavy loads. In contrast, carriages provided a more comfortable mode of transport for individuals, often elaborately decorated to signify status. Chariots, utilized in ancient warfare and competitive events, exemplify the diverse applications of horse-drawn transport.

The engineering of these vehicles evolved over time, with innovations in wheel design, axle mechanics, and materials leading to improved speed and stability. This adaptability allowed societies to expand trade, connect communities, and facilitate cultural exchange, reinforcing the significance of animal domestication for transport.

As urbanization progressed, horse-drawn vehicles remained pivotal until mechanical alternatives emerged. Their enduring legacy highlights the profound impact of animal domestication in shaping transportation methods that laid the groundwork for modern systems.

Sleds Pulled by Dogs

Sleds pulled by dogs represent a significant aspect of animal domestication for transport, particularly in cold or snowy regions. This innovative transportation method has been used by various cultures for centuries, effectively adapting to harsh climates where traditional means fall short.

The design of sleds varies depending on their purpose. Key features include:

  • Lightweight Frame: Reduces drag and increases speed.
  • Flexible Runners: Allows for maneuverability on snow.
  • Harnessing System: Ensures efficient attachment of dogs to the sled.

Dogs, particularly breeds like Siberian Huskies and Alaskan Malamutes, are well-suited for pulling sleds. Their strength, stamina, and ability to work in packs make them ideal for transporting goods and individuals. This form of transport has facilitated trade and exploration in challenging environments, demonstrating the importance of animal domestication for transport throughout history.

While modern mechanical means have evolved, sleds pulled by dogs remain relevant in certain communities for seasonal events, outdoor recreation, and logistical support in remote areas. This method exemplifies the lasting impact of animal domestication on transport methods globally.
